More about the book
Exploring the emotional landscapes of home, the narrative delves into the complex relationship humans have with the often-maligned lanternfly. Through this unique perspective, Gow examines themes of belonging, identity, and the intersections of nature and humanity, inviting readers to reflect on how perceptions of home can be shaped by both personal and ecological factors.
